How to Pray for a Sick Friend

Praying for a sick friend involves sincerity, faith, and intention. Here are some guidelines to help you pray meaningfully:

1. Prepare Your Heart

Find a quiet place where you can focus without distractions. Clear your mind and open your heart to connect with God sincerely.

2. Speak with Faith and Compassion

Express your prayers clearly, believing in God’s power to heal. Include words of comfort and encouragement for your friend.

3. Ask for Specific Healing

Pray for physical healing, emotional strength, and spiritual peace. You may also ask for wisdom for the doctors and caregivers.

4. Include Scripture

Incorporate Bible verses that affirm God’s healing promises to strengthen your prayer.

5. Pray Consistently

Make prayer a regular part of your routine to offer ongoing support and faith.

Example Healing Prayers for a Sick Friend

Here are some heartfelt prayers you can use or adapt to pray for your sick friend:

Prayer for Physical Healing

Dear Lord, I lift up my friend to You in this time of illness. Please touch their body with Your healing hands and restore them to full health. Grant them strength to overcome this challenge and peace to face each day. In Jesus’ name, Amen.

Prayer for Emotional Strength

Heavenly Father, please comfort my friend in their sickness. Surround them with Your love and calm their fears and worries. Help them to feel Your presence and find hope in Your promises. Amen.

Prayer for Wisdom and Guidance

Lord, I ask that You grant wisdom to the doctors and caregivers attending to my friend. Guide their hands and decisions so that the best treatment and care are provided. May Your will be done, and may healing come swiftly. Amen.
